Key Insights
- Confidence is crucial for fluency. Fluent speakers make mistakes but continue communicating, focusing on the conversation's flow rather than perfection.
- Active listening is foundational for fluency. It involves focusing on pronunciation, sentence patterns, and word usage to improve speaking skills.
- Shadowing is an effective technique for improving listening and speaking simultaneously, helping learners match native speakers' flow and confidence.
- Repetition strengthens memory and builds confidence, making it easier to recall and use phrases in real conversations.
- Imagining conversations prepares learners for real-life scenarios, reducing anxiety and making interactions more natural.
- Thinking in English speeds up speaking and comprehension, avoiding translation errors and making communication more comfortable.
- Using English daily, through changing device language settings or consuming English media, helps internalize the language.
- Patience and consistency are key in language learning. Progress may be slow, but every small step is a victory towards fluency.

Questions & Answers
Q: What is the role of confidence in achieving fluency?
Confidence is essential for fluency as it allows speakers to convey their message effectively despite making mistakes. Fluent speakers focus on the flow of conversation and trust their ability to communicate, which helps them overcome vocabulary or grammar limitations.
Q: How does active listening contribute to language learning?
Active listening involves concentrating on pronunciation, sentence patterns, and word usage. It helps learners recognize and remember the rhythms and patterns of English, making speaking feel more natural and less intimidating. This technique lays the foundation for fluent speech.
Q: What is the shadowing technique and how does it help?
Shadowing involves imitating a native speaker's speech to match their flow and confidence. By listening carefully and repeating sentences, learners build muscle memory for speaking, internalizing correct pronunciation and sentence flow, which boosts both listening and speaking skills.
Q: Why is repetition important in language learning?
Repetition creates strong connections in the brain, making it easier to recall phrases quickly. It builds confidence and familiarity with sentence structures and pronunciation, allowing learners to use phrases effortlessly in real conversations, much like learning to ride a bike.
Q: How can imagining conversations benefit learners?
Imagining conversations prepares learners for real-life scenarios by practicing the language they will use. This mental rehearsal reduces anxiety and helps learners feel more confident and prepared for interactions, as they already know what to say and how to say it.
Q: What are the benefits of thinking in English?
Thinking in English helps avoid translation errors and speeds up speaking and comprehension. It makes communication more comfortable by allowing learners to think directly in the target language, reducing the time needed to form sentences and increasing fluency.
Q: Why is it important to use English daily?
Using English daily helps internalize the language, making it a natural part of the learner's life. Changing device language settings, consuming English media, and practicing regularly ensure consistent exposure, which is crucial for language acquisition and fluency.
Q: How should learners approach language learning to avoid frustration?
Learners should focus on progress rather than perfection, celebrating small victories and understanding that mistakes are learning opportunities. Consistency in practice, patience, and maintaining motivation through clear goals help overcome challenges and achieve fluency over time.
